- Title
Figuring Phantasmagoria: The Tradition of the Fantastic in Irish Modernism.
- Authors
Beville, Maria
- Abstract
The article focuses on the concept of phantasmagoria as a prominent feature of Irish Modernist literature. Topics discussed include the linked poetry and prose of Irish authors W. B. Yeats, James Joyce, and Samuel Beckett, and the presence of Gothic fantastic forms in their literary works. A national version of the literary fantastic that is closely related to Modernism and contextualized in coetaneous social and political issues is examined.
